A man has been jailed after a loaded gun was found hidden in an extractor fan in a kitchen in Salford. Officers burst into the property on Langworthy Road on the morning on April 26 last year.
They found that the loaded .32 calibre revolver in the kitchen in a search. Marco McKenzie had placed it there, Greater Manchester Police said.
The 26-year-old was arrested and taken into custody. READ MORE: Police stop 'suspicious-looking' man in the street and find a lot of dirty cash McKenzie, of Old Moat Lane, Withington, was then charged with possession of a firearm.
